The MUSITREND 10 in 1 Record Player is a versatile stereo system aimed at those who appreciate both vintage and modern audio formats. One of its standout features is its ability to play a wide range of media, including vinyl records, CDs, cassettes, and digital files via USB and SD cards. Additionally, it comes with Bluetooth connectivity, allowing you to stream music from your smartphone or other Bluetooth-enabled devices.
The dual external speakers, rated at 10W each, provide decent sound quality and are sufficiently loud for most small to medium-sized rooms. However, audiophiles may find the sound quality lacking in depth and clarity compared to higher-end systems. The build quality is reasonable, utilizing engineered wood, although it may not feel as premium as some other models. It's relatively easy to use, thanks in part to the included remote control, and the auto-stop feature on the turntable is a useful addition for vinyl enthusiasts.
The ability to convert vinyl, CDs, and cassettes to MP3 format is another handy feature for those looking to digitize their music collection. While its size and design are somewhat bulky, it does offer a nostalgic aesthetic that might appeal to some users. In summary, this record player is a solid option for those seeking an all-in-one audio solution with multiple playback options and decent sound quality, although it may not satisfy the needs of high-end audio purists.
The TEAC AD-850-SE is a versatile audio system that combines a high-quality cassette deck and a CD player with modern features like USB recording and playback. It offers useful cassette functions such as pitch control and supports different tape types, which is a strong plus for cassette enthusiasts. The CD player handles standard discs and MP3 files with easy-to-use playback options, making it great for listening to a variety of music formats.
One standout feature is the microphone input with echo effect, which is perfect for karaoke, although you will need your own amplifier and speakers since it doesn’t include built-in speakers. Connectivity is wired only, which keeps things simple but limits wireless options. Notably, this system does not include a turntable, so if you’re looking for vinyl playback, this unit won’t meet that need. The build quality appears solid with a compact and attractive silver design, though it weighs 16 pounds, so it’s not ultra-light.
The TEAC AD-850-SE is suited for users who want a reliable cassette and CD player combo with USB recording and karaoke features, but those seeking a complete all-in-one stereo with turntable and built-in speakers may prefer other options.
The Pareiko 10 in 1 Vintage Record Player offers a lot of versatility by combining a 3-speed turntable (33/45/78 RPM) with CD, cassette, and digital media playback (USB, SD, and MMC cards). This makes it great for someone who enjoys various music formats without needing multiple devices. The included dual external speakers deliver clear stereo sound with decent bass, enhancing listening whether you’re hosting guests or relaxing at home. Bluetooth wireless streaming adds modern convenience, and the remote control lets you easily manage playback from a distance—a nice touch for comfort.
The turntable’s retro wood design is attractive and fits well in vintage or classic-themed rooms, giving it both style and substance. It also supports AM/FM radio, expanding your listening options beyond stored music. The cassette deck offers basic functionality but, as with many modern multi-format players, its performance might not match dedicated cassette units.
Connectivity options are solid for this type of system, covering wired and wireless needs, though it relies on a corded power source, which limits portability. At about 13.7 pounds, it’s moderately heavy but still manageable for placement on shelves or tables. This player suits users who want a stylish all-in-one music center with vintage vibes and modern features, perfect for casual listening and nostalgia. If you're primarily focused on high-end vinyl sound or cassette quality, you might notice some compromises. Otherwise, it’s a well-rounded choice for enjoying varied audio formats with ease.
